It's not clear that you're looking for comments but......
1. Get your pH down into 7.2-7.6 range with muriatic acid
2. Reread the instructions for the Alk test and repeat. If that result is correct, (I don't think it is) it may be a world record.:)
3. Without CYA, chlorine quickly disappears in daylight. Add it in the evening to be most effective. Once the CYA is established, Cl will do better in the daytime. CYA will last all Summer, at least.

OK. I got my CYA up to 40 ppm. That should help my Chlorine from dying so quickly.
As for reducing my Alk... I started the aeration process Saturday night. I don't think I did it right. My pH was 8.2 Sat night. Over the next 2 days I kept pouring in acid & some left over store bought pH Lowerer. I checked the pH and it always read high(8.2). Monday night I tested for Alk again and this time it was over 600 before the solution turned from green to a slight red/clearish. So now I"m starting over. I stopped the aeration and dumped a bunch of acid in last night. Checked pH this morning and it was down around 7.8. I'm going to keep lowering until it gets to ~6.6(as per instructions) then start aerating again.
